Transaction 43a58a2f9d55a4f3acf53cba28441b01f281c953e5283ffcf458907a342fd159

1 Input
2 Outputs
  • 43a58a2f9d55a4f3acf53cba28441b01f281c953e5283ffcf458907a342fd159:0
  • value  8033528
    address  18QGicEqXvpAijhPn6fcn4taecSDaKaF4S
  • 43a58a2f9d55a4f3acf53cba28441b01f281c953e5283ffcf458907a342fd159:1
  • value  4225100
    address  17C3ngbymZdGmcPdmFV7fKeyvNeqiLoWZu